Photographing Fast-paced Motorsports in Scotland

We managed to spend an incredible day at the Knockhill Motorsport Race Course in Scotland taking shots of the high speed cars going around the legendary track competing in a number of championships held that day.

To capture the events being held all day I used the Fujifilm X-H2S fitted with the Fujinon XF50-140mmF2.8 R LM OIS WR lens. The camera is set to manual throughout the events with a low shutter speed (1/30) to capture the cars at high speed whilst blurring the background. For action shots showing the cars compete the shutter is set high, 1/1000+ to ensure the power moves are captured.

In the pit lane the Fuji X-T15 was used along with either the excellent FUJINON XF16-55mmF2.8 R LM WR II or FUJINON XF23mmF1.4 R LM WR to capture the crews getting the cars ready for the next big race.
